We found out the first part of September that Natalie has Type 1 Diabetes. She'd been sick for a while, but we couldn't quite pinpoint what was wrong. She started laying around and sleeping all the time and then losing weight. Then when she started being thirsty and going to the bathroom all the time Rob and I were very suspicious. So I took her to her pediatrician and she had us go straight to the hospital after Natalie's urine test came back with lots of sugar in it. Natalie was there for almost a week, getting her levels back to a normal range. Rob was able to take the week off and be there with her 24/7 so I could be home with the other kids.
